Step-by-step explanation:

recall law of Sines :  Sin(A) / a = Sin(B) / b

where F can be A, in above equation,  and then a = 30

we want to find E so that can be B, and b = 18

Sin(78) / 30 = Sin(B) / 18

solve the parts you can

0.03260 = Sin(B) / 18

18 * 0.03260 = Sin(B)

0.5868885 = Sin(B)

use  arcSin() to find angle of B

arcSin(0.586885)  = arcSin( Sin(B))  [ b/c arcSin is the inverse of Sin those go away, they cancel each other out ]

35.9365 = B

36° = B  ( and B = E in the given triangle )

∠E = 36°
